Exploring the Diversity of Powder Coating Systems: Electrostatic, and Fluidized Bed

 

Powder coating has emerged as a versatile and efficient finishing solution for a wide range of industries, offering durability, aesthetics, and environmental benefits. Within the realm of powder coating systems, several methods have been developed, each with its own unique characteristics and applications. In this article, we delve into two prominent types of powder coating systems: Electrostatic, and Fluidized Bed.

Electrostatic Powder Coating: 

Electrostatic powder coating is one of the most widely used methods in the industry. It involves the application of charged powder particles onto a grounded substrate. The powder is electrostatically charged using a spray gun, which creates a strong attraction between the powder and the grounded object. This results in uniform coverage and adhesion of the powder particles. Electrostatic powder coating systems are suitable for various materials, including metal, plastic, and wood, making them ideal for applications in automotive, aerospace, and architectural industries.

Fluidized Bed Powder Coating: 

Fluidized bed powder coating utilizes a bed of powder particles suspended in air to coat substrates. The substrate is preheated and then immersed into the fluidized powder bed, where the powder particles adhere to its surface. The coated substrate is then cured to form a durable finish. Fluidized bed coating systems are particularly effective for coating objects with complex shapes and large surface areas, such as metal fences, outdoor furniture, and agricultural equipment. They provide excellent coverage and thickness control, resulting in robust and corrosion-resistant coatings.
